    The Wanted think Aguilera needs to learn manners

    The Wanted say Christina Aguilera needs to learn some manners but do regret calling her a "total bitch".


    The Wanted say Christina Aguilera needs to learn some manners.

    The 'Glad You Came' hitmakers - made up of Max George, Tom Parker, Nathan Sykes, Siva Kaneswara and Jay McGuiness - branded the singer a "total bitch" last week and while they admit they shouldn't have said it, they still believe she was very rude.

    Tom told TMZ.com: "We shouldn't have said it, to be honest with you. We just think manners cost nothing, you know what I mean?"

    After meeting the 'Beautiful' hitmaker backstage at US talent show 'The Voice' - on which she is a coach - the band were not impressed with her behaviour.

    Tom said: "She's a total bitch! She might not be a bitch in real life but to us she was a bitch. She just sat there and didn't speak to us."

    Bandmate Max added: "She was a bit scary to be honest."

    Siva said: "You know what, she was quite rude."

    The boy band also claimed Christina shunned Justin Bieber when he attempted to embrace her.

    Nathan said: "She might have been in a bad mood that day - didn't she completely par Justin Bieber as well? He went in for a hug and she was like, 'Get away from me.' "
